Recent Attacks on Hash Functions and Their Impact on Hash-Based Security Schemes
Speaker: Yiqun Lisa Yin - Independent Security Consultant
Time and Place: Monday 4/23 at 11am in LC102
This talk will first provide a survey of recent attacks on hash
functions. We will review new techniques introduced in these attacks and
analyze some common weaknesses in the design of existing hash functions that
made all the attacks possible. We will then consider the impact of these
attacks on hash-based security schemes. We will present new results on
colliding the X.509 digital certificates and key-recovery attacks on the HMAC
authentication protocol. These results show that the strength of a security
scheme can be greatly weakened by the insecurity of the underlying hash
